




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年监理工程师职业能力测试卷(信息技术应用)考试时间:______分钟总分:______分姓名:______一、计算机网络基础要求:本部分主要考察学生对计算机网络基本概念、网络协议、网络拓扑结构以及网络设备的理解和应用能力。1.简述OSI七层模型的每一层的主要功能。2.请列举三种常见的网络拓扑结构及其特点。3.什么是IP地址?简述IP地址的分类。4.简述TCP协议和UDP协议的主要区别。5.什么是子网掩码?简述子网掩码的作用。6.简述DNS的作用及其工作原理。7.什么是VLAN?简述VLAN的作用。8.简述防火墙的作用及其工作原理。9.什么是VPN?简述VPN的作用。10.简述无线局域网(WLAN)的组成及工作原理。二、操作系统要求:本部分主要考察学生对操作系统基本概念、进程管理、内存管理、文件系统以及设备管理的理解和应用能力。1.简述操作系统的功能。2.什么是进程?简述进程的状态及其转换。3.什么是线程?简述线程与进程的区别。4.简述进程调度算法及其优缺点。5.什么是内存管理?简述内存管理的几种常用算法。6.什么是虚拟内存?简述虚拟内存的作用及工作原理。7.什么是文件系统?简述文件系统的组成及功能。8.简述文件目录的作用。9.什么是磁盘碎片?简述磁盘碎片整理的作用。10.简述设备管理的任务及其实现方法。三、数据库基础要求:本部分主要考察学生对数据库基本概念、关系模型、SQL语言以及数据库设计的基本原则和方法的掌握。1.简述数据库的基本概念。2.什么是关系模型?简述关系模型的三要素。3.什么是实体-关系(E-R)模型?简述E-R模型的作用。4.什么是SQL语言?简述SQL语言的主要功能。5.什么是数据完整性?简述数据完整性的类型。6.什么是规范化?简述第一范式、第二范式、第三范式。7.什么是数据库设计?简述数据库设计的基本步骤。8.什么是数据库安全?简述数据库安全的主要措施。9.什么是数据库备份与恢复?简述数据库备份与恢复的方法。10.什么是分布式数据库?简述分布式数据库的特点。四、软件工程要求:本部分主要考察学生对软件工程基本概念、软件生命周期、软件需求分析、软件设计以及软件测试的理解和应用能力。1.简述软件工程的基本目标。2.什么是软件生命周期?简述软件生命周期的各个阶段。3.什么是软件需求分析?简述需求分析的主要任务和方法。4.什么是软件设计?简述软件设计的基本原则和任务。5.什么是软件测试?简述软件测试的类型和目的。6.什么是软件维护?简述软件维护的类型和内容。7.简述软件项目管理的任务和方法。8.什么是敏捷开发?简述敏捷开发的优势和特点。9.什么是软件质量?简述软件质量的度量方法和指标。10.简述软件可靠性的概念及其重要性。五、网络编程要求:本部分主要考察学生对网络编程基本概念、网络协议、编程语言网络编程接口以及网络编程应用的掌握。1.简述网络编程的基本概念。2.什么是Socket编程?简述Socket编程的基本原理。3.什么是HTTP协议?简述HTTP协议的工作原理。4.什么是TCP协议?简述TCP协议的特点和优势。5.什么是UDP协议?简述UDP协议的特点和适用场景。6.什么是多线程编程?简述多线程编程的优势和应用。7.什么是网络编程中的并发控制?简述并发控制的方法和策略。8.什么是网络编程中的同步机制?简述同步机制的类型和实现方式。9.什么是网络编程中的错误处理?简述错误处理的方法和原则。10.简述网络编程中的安全性问题和解决方案。六、信息安全要求:本部分主要考察学生对信息安全基本概念、安全策略、加密技术、身份认证以及安全协议的理解和应用能力。1.简述信息安全的基本概念。2.什么是安全策略?简述安全策略的制定和实施。3.什么是加密技术?简述加密技术的基本原理和类型。4.什么是哈希函数?简述哈希函数的作用和特点。5.什么是数字签名?简述数字签名的原理和应用。6.什么是身份认证?简述身份认证的方法和机制。7.什么是访问控制?简述访问控制的方法和策略。8.什么是安全协议?简述安全协议的类型和作用。9.什么是入侵检测系统?简述入侵检测系统的原理和功能。10.什么是安全审计?简述安全审计的目的和方法。本次试卷答案如下:一、计算机网络基础1.解析:OSI七层模型包括物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。物理层负责传输比特流;数据链路层负责传输数据帧;网络层负责传输数据包;传输层负责端到端的通信;会话层负责建立、管理和终止会话;表示层负责数据表示、加密和压缩;应用层负责提供网络服务。2.解析:常见的网络拓扑结构包括星型拓扑、环型拓扑、总线拓扑和树型拓扑。星型拓扑结构简单,便于管理;环型拓扑结构简单,易于扩展;总线拓扑结构简单,成本较低;树型拓扑结构层次分明,易于扩展。3.解析:IP地址是InternetProtocolAddress的缩写,用于唯一标识网络中的设备。IP地址分为A、B、C、D、E五类,其中A、B、C类地址用于大型网络,D类地址用于多播,E类地址保留。4.解析:TCP协议是一种面向连接的、可靠的、基于字节流的传输层通信协议,提供数据传输的可靠性保证。UDP协议是一种无连接的、不可靠的、基于报文的传输层通信协议,提供数据传输的高效性。5.解析:子网掩码是用于划分网络地址的一部分,用于确定一个IP地址的网络地址部分和主机地址部分。子网掩码的作用是将网络地址和主机地址分开。6.解析:DNS(DomainNameSystem)域名系统,用于将域名转换为IP地址。DNS的工作原理是查询域名服务器,将域名转换为IP地址。7.解析:VLAN(VirtualLocalAreaNetwork)虚拟局域网,是一种将物理上连接在一起的设备逻辑上划分成不同网络的技术。VLAN的作用是提高网络的安全性和灵活性。8.解析:防火墙是一种网络安全设备,用于监控和控制进出网络的流量。防火墙的作用是防止非法访问和保护内部网络。9.解析:VPN(VirtualPrivateNetwork)虚拟专用网络,是一种通过公用网络(如Internet)建立专用网络的技术。VPN的作用是保护数据传输的安全性。10.解析:WLAN(WirelessLocalAreaNetwork)无线局域网,是一种通过无线信号实现局域网通信的技术。WLAN的组成包括无线接入点、无线终端和无线介质。二、操作系统1.解析:操作系统的功能包括进程管理、内存管理、文件系统、设备管理和用户接口。2.解析:进程是操作系统进行资源分配和调度的一个独立单位,其状态包括创建、就绪、运行、阻塞和终止。3.解析:线程是进程中的一个实体,被系统独立调度和分派的基本单位。线程与进程的区别在于线程是进程的一部分,而进程是系统进行资源分配和调度的基本单位。4.解析:进程调度算法包括先来先服务(FCFS)、短作业优先(SJF)、优先级调度和轮转调度等。每种算法都有其优缺点。5.解析:内存管理包括内存分配、内存回收和内存保护。内存管理的常用算法有固定分区、可变分区、分页和分段等。6.解析:虚拟内存是一种将部分物理内存空间模拟成逻辑内存空间的技术,用于扩大程序可用内存空间。7.解析:文件系统负责管理文件的存储、检索和更新。文件系统的组成包括文件目录、文件和文件控制块。8.解析:文件目录是文件系统中用于组织和管理文件的逻辑结构,用于快速定位文件。9.解析:磁盘碎片整理是指将磁盘上分散的数据重新整理成连续的数据块,提高磁盘的读写速度。10.解析:磁盘碎片是指磁盘上连续存储空间被不连续分割的情况,导致磁盘性能下降。三、数据库基础1.解析:数据库是存储、管理和检索数据的系统,具有数据完整性、数据一致性和数据共享等特点。2.解析:关系模型包括实体、属性和关系。实体是数据库中的对象,属性是实体的特征,关系是实体之间的联系。3.解析:E-R模型是实体-关系模型,用于表示数据库中的实体、属性和关系,有助于数据库设计。4.解析:SQL(StructuredQueryLanguage)是一种用于数据库查询、更新、插入和删除的语言。5.解析:数据完整性包括实体完整性、参照完整性、用户定义完整性。6.解析:规范化是将数据库设计成避免数据冗余和更新异常的过程,包括第一范式、第二范式、第三范式。7.解析:数据库设计包括需求分析、概念设计、逻辑设计和物理设计。8.解析:数据库安全包括数据加密、访问控制、备份与恢复。9.解析:数据库备份是指将数据库中的数据复制到其他存储介质上,以防止数据丢失。10.解析:分布式数据库是分散存储在多个地理位置的数据库,具有数据分布性、透明性和一致性等特点。四、软件工程1.解析:软件工程是一种应用工程、科学和管理原则来开发、运行和维护软件的方法。2.解析:软件生命周期包括需求分析、设计、编码、测试、部署和维护等阶段。3.解析:需求分析是确定软件需要实现的功能和性能的过程。4.解析:软件设计是确定软件系统结构、组件和接口的过程。5.解析:软件测试是验证软件是否满足需求、功能和性能的过程。6.解析:软件维护是确保软件在生命周期内持续正常运行的过程。7.解析:软件项目管理是规划、组织、领导和控制软件项目的过程。8.解析:敏捷开发是一种以人为核心、迭代、持续交付和响应变化的软件开发方法。9.解析:软件质量是指软件满足用户需求、功能和性能的程度。10.解析:软件可靠性是指软件在特定条件下执行特定功能的能力。五、网络编程1.解析:网络编程是指使用编程语言和网络协议编写能够实现网络通信的程序。2.解析:Socket编程是一种网络编程接口,用于实现进程间的网络通信。3.解析:HTTP协议是一种应用层协议,用于在Web浏览器和Web服务器之间传输数据。4.解析:TCP协议是一种传输层协议,提供面向连接、可靠的字节流服务。5.解析:UDP协议是一种传输层协议,提供无连接、不可靠的报文传输服务。6.解析:多线程编程是一种编程技术,允许一个程序同时执行多个线程。7.解析:并发控制是指确保多个进程或线程在共享资源时不会发生冲突的技术。8.解析:同步机制是指控制线程或进程在特定条件下执行的技术,如互斥锁、信号量和条件变量。9.解析:错误处理是指识别、记录和响应程序运行中的错误的技术。10.解析:网络编程中的安全性问题包括数据泄露、恶意攻击和网络钓鱼等,解决方案包括加密、身份认证和访问控制等。六、信息安全1.解析:信息安全是指保护信息资产免受未经授权的访问、使用、披露、破坏、修改或破坏的技术和管理措施。2.解析:安全策略是指一组指导原则和规则,用于保护信息安全。3.解析:加密技术是一种将明文转换为密文的技术,用于保护数据传输和存储的安全性。4.解析:哈希函数是一种将任意长度的数据映射为固定长度数据的技术,用
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 浙江省稽阳联谊学校2025年4月高三联考数学试卷(含答案)
- 《人生的意义在于奉献》课件
- 《演讲的艺术》课件
- 受弯构件的其他构造要求钢筋混凝土结构课件
- 短期合同续签建议
- 铁路班组管理S班组凝聚力训练课件
- 讨论照明电路能否采用三相三线制供电方式不加零线会不会出现问
- 网格桥架安装施工方案
- 铁路客运站车无线交互系统客运管理部分课件
- 大学生职业规划大赛《视觉传达设计专业》生涯发展展示
- 任务三家庭清扫有工序(教学课件)二年级下册劳动技术(人美版)
- 电商订单处理流程优化计划
- 建筑工程检测行业市场现状分析及未来三到五年发展趋势报告
- 高炉水渣基础知识
- 肿瘤标志物的试题及答案
- 烟草行业网络安全体系建设
- 2025年中考地理二轮复习:中考地理常见易混易错知识点与练习题(含答案)
- 硫酸使用安全培训
- 政务服务窗口培训课件
- 2025年湖南湘潭高新集团有限公司招聘笔试参考题库含答案解析
- 2024年02月福建2024年兴业银行福州分行金融科技人才招考笔试历年参考题库附带答案详解
评论
0/150
提交评论